Free typing test
Programmer typing guides by language
Symbol-heavy code-line practice with snippets filtered to your stack. Each language guide embeds a three-minute test locked to that track—not a random mix from the full corpus.
Free test
Run a programmer symbols typing test
Three-minute timed runs on braces, operators, and language-specific snippets—or open a language guide for a track-locked embed.
Step 1
Open the symbols test
Mixed corpus or pick a language track from a guide.
Step 2
Type code-shaped snippets
Brackets, strings, and operators at realistic density.
Step 3
Open your stack’s guide
Each language article locks the embed to that track.
No download. Sign in to save scores; open any language guide for a track-specific embed.
Compare language track guides →Typing for Programmers · Language tracks
Ansible Typing Practice: Playbook YAML, Modules, and Infra Symbol Fluency
Train Ansible playbook rhythm—list markers, module keys, and indented tasks—with a three-minute Ansible-track symbols test, YAML drills, and weekly transfer to real playbooks.
Read guide
Typing for Programmers · Language tracks
Assembly Typing Test: Mnemonics, Registers, and Low-Level Symbol Fluency
Practice a free three-minute Assembly programmer symbols test—commas, brackets, semicolons, and mnemonic lines from the Assembly track only, with weekly transfer checks for systems work.
Read guide
Typing for Programmers · Language tracks
Bash Typing Test: Shell Operators, Flags, and Script Punctuation
Train Bash script punctuation with a three-minute locked-track symbols test—dollar braces, pipes, flags, and path quotes from the Bash corpus, plus weekly terminal transfer checks.
Read guide
Typing for Programmers · Language tracks
C Typing Test: Pointers, Braces, and Semicolon Rhythm for Systems Code
Practice C pointer stars, brace blocks, and semicolon-terminated statements with a three-minute locked-track programmer symbols test and weekly transfer snippets from real headers.
Read guide
Typing for Programmers · Language tracks
Clojure Typing Test: Parentheses, Threading Macros, and Keyword Syntax
Practice a free three-minute Clojure programmer symbols test—threading arrows, keyword colons, anonymous fn shorthand
Read guide
Typing for Programmers · Language tracks
COBOL Typing Test: Columns, Divisions, and Picture Clause Rhythm
Practice a free three-minute COBOL programmer symbols test—fixed columns, division headers, level numbers, and PIC clauses from the COBOL track only, with weekly mainframe transfer checks.
Read guide





